Ambitious Arkansas LPNs are increasingly opting to continue their education and move up in the nursing field by pursuing an RN degree. The state has numerous programs, with both LPN to ADN and LPN to BSN pathways available. There are many advantages to becoming an RN, including more autonomy, the ability to enter coveted specialties, and the potential for a higher salary. In fact, the Bureau of Labor Statistics reports that RNs in Arkansas make nearly $21,000 more per year than LPNs in the state do.

The table below compares the annual salary of a licensed practical nurse (LPN) to a registered nurse (RN), along with the percent increase that can be expected. The data was organized by the Bureau of Labor Statistics for LPNs and RNs in Arkansas.

On average an RN in Arkansas earns $41,353, which is 14% less than the national average for registered nurses ($48,109).

City/AreaAvg LPN SalaryAvg RN Salary% Diff
Little Rock, North Little Rock, Conway - AR$42,080$65,03054.5%
Fayetteville, Springdale, Rogers - AR$44,200$60,57037.0%
Fort Smith - AR$41,480$57,84039.4%
Jonesboro - AR$37,070$57,72055.7%
Hot Springs - AR$38,410$59,13053.9%
Pine Bluff - AR$35,840$62,69074.9%

Table data taken from 2018 BLS https://www.bls.gov/oes/current/oes291141.htm & https://www.bls.gov/oes/current/oes292061.htm
